What are the correct repositories?

I’m in the process of installing and configuring LEAP 15.2 beta, and I’ve run into some repository issues. My repositories are

ARCAOS-40ADEE0:~ # zypper lr -Pu
#  | Alias                     | Name                               | Enabled | GPG Check | Refresh | Priority | URI                                                                     
---+---------------------------+------------------------------------+---------+-----------+---------+----------+-------------------------------------------------------------------------
 2 | packman                   | packman                            | Yes     | (r ) Yes  | Yes     |   80     | http://packman.inode.at/suse/openSUSE_Leap_15.2/Essentials              
 1 | openSUSE-Leap-15.2-1      | openSUSE-Leap-15.2-1               | No      | ----      | ----    |   99     | cd:/?devices=/dev/disk/by-id/ata-HL-DT-ST_DVDRAM_GH24NSB0_K7OD9HF4441   
 3 | repo-debug                | Debug Repository                   | No      | ----      | ----    |   99     | http://download.opensuse.org/debug/distribution/leap/15.2/repo/oss/     
 4 | repo-debug-non-oss        | Debug Repository (Non-OSS)         | No      | ----      | ----    |   99     | http://download.opensuse.org/debug/distribution/leap/15.2/repo/non-oss/ 
 5 | repo-debug-update         | Update Repository (Debug)          | No      | ----      | ----    |   99     | http://download.opensuse.org/debug/update/leap/15.2/oss/                
 6 | repo-debug-update-non-oss | Update Repository (Debug, Non-OSS) | No      | ----      | ----    |   99     | http://download.opensuse.org/debug/update/leap/15.2/non-oss/            
 7 | repo-non-oss              | Non-OSS Repository                 | Yes     | (r ) Yes  | Yes     |   99     | http://download.opensuse.org/distribution/leap/15.2/repo/non-oss/       
 8 | repo-oss                  | Main Repository                    | Yes     | (r ) Yes  | Yes     |   99     | http://download.opensuse.org/distribution/leap/15.2/repo/oss/           
 9 | repo-source               | Source Repository                  | No      | ----      | ----    |   99     | http://download.opensuse.org/source/distribution/leap/15.2/repo/oss/    
10 | repo-source-non-oss       | Source Repository (Non-OSS)        | No      | ----      | ----    |   99     | http://download.opensuse.org/source/distribution/leap/15.2/repo/non-oss/
11 | repo-update               | Main Update Repository             | Yes     | (r ) Yes  | Yes     |   99     | http://download.opensuse.org/update/leap/15.2/oss                       
12 | repo-update-non-oss       | Update Repository (Non-Oss)        | Yes     | (r ) Yes  | Yes     |   99     | http://download.opensuse.org/update/leap/15.2/non-oss/  

The first issue is there used to be a Publishing/TeXLive repository for 15.1, and I can’t find it for 15.2. The second is that the list of community repositories is almost empty, and does not include packman. Last, I get out-of-date error messages on one of the standard repositories:

ARCAOS-40ADEE0:~ # zypper --non-interactive in bind-doc                        \
>                             books                           \
>                             bzip2-doc                       \
>                             createrepo                      \
>                             docbook-tdg                     \
>                             dosbox                          \
>                             dosemu                          \
>                             emacs-info                      \
>                             exim                            \
>                             filezilla                       \
>                             gcc-ada                         \
>                             gcc-info                        \
>                             go-doc                          \
>                             gramps                          \
>                             gvim                            \
>                             gzip                            \
>                             hddtemp                         \
>                             kernel-docs                     \
>                             lftp                            \
>                             lyx                             \
>                             mathgl-doc                      \
>                             mathgl-doc-pdf                  \
>                             mc                              \
>                             memtest86+                      \
>                             nfs-doc                         \
>                             'ooRexx*'                       \
>                             pciutils-ids                    \
>                             pcre-devel                      \
>                             pcre-doc                        \
>                             pcre-tools                      \
>                             pdfcompare                      \
>                             pdfgrep                         \
>                             perl-Data-Dump                  \
>                             perl-Digest-MD5                 \
>                             perl-Email-Date-Format          \
>                             perl-ExtUtils-MakeMaker         \
>                             perl-ExtUtils-XSpp              \
>                             perl-IO-String                  \
>                             perl-MIME-Types                 \
>                             perl-MIME-tools                 \
>                             perl-Mail-DKIM                  \
>                             perl-Mail-SPF                   \
>                             perl-Module-Build-XSUtil        \
>                             perl-Params-Util                \
>                             perl-Pod-Usage                  \
>                             perl-Regexp-Common              \
>                             perl-XSLoader                   \
>                             perl-version                    \
>                             postfix                         \
>                             postfix-doc                     \
>                             postgresql                      \
>                             postgresql-contrib              \
>                             postgresql-docs                 \
>                             postgresql-server               \
>                             python-doc                      \
>                             python-doc-pdf                  \
>                             qpdfview                        \
>                             'Regina-*'                      \
>                             rmt-server                      \
>                             ruby2.5-doc                     \
>                             ruby2.5-doc-ri                  \
>                             ruby2.5-rubygem-abstract        \
>                             ruby2.5-rubygem-abstract-doc    \
>                             rust-doc                        \
>                             samba-doc                       \
>                             sendfax                         \
>                             sensors                         \
>                             subversion-doc                  \
>                             swig                            \
>                             swig-doc                        \
>                             swig-examples                   \
>                             systemd-coredump                \
>                             texlive-indextools              \
>                             texlive-indextools-doc          \
>                             texlive-showlabels              \
>                             texlive-stix2-otf               \
>                             texlive-stix2-otf-doc           \
>                             texlive-stix2-otf-fonts         \
>                             texlive-stix2-type1             \
>                             texlive-stix2-type1-doc         \
>                             texlive-stix2-type1-fonts       \
>                             texlive-texware                 \
>                             texlive-thmtools                \
>                             texlive-thmtools-doc            \
>                             texmaker                        \
>                             texworks                        \
>                             'THE*'                          \
>                             unicode-ucd                     \
>                             w3c-markup-validator            \
>                             whois                           \
>                             xemacs                          \
>                             xemacs-info                     \
>                             xorg-docs                       \
>                             yast2-rmt
Loading repository data...
Warning: Repository 'Update Repository (Non-Oss)' appears to be outdated. Consider using a different mirror or server.
Reading installed packages...
Package 'texlive-stix2-otf' not found.
Package 'texlive-stix2-type1' not found.
'pcre-devel' is already installed.
No update candidate for 'pcre-devel-8.41-lp152.6.79.x86_64'. The highest available version is already installed.
'swig' is already installed.
No update candidate for 'swig-3.0.12-lp152.6.6.x86_64'. The highest available version is already installed.
'gzip' is already installed.
No update candidate for 'gzip-1.10-lp152.1.59.x86_64'. The highest available version is already installed.
'postfix' is already installed.
No update candidate for 'postfix-3.4.7-lp152.1.18.x86_64'. The highest available version is already installed.
'sensors' is already installed.
No update candidate for 'sensors-3.5.0-lp152.1.4.x86_64'. The highest available version is already installed.
'gcc-info' is already installed.
No update candidate for 'gcc-info-7-lp152.4.89.x86_64'. The highest available version is already installed.
'nfs-doc' is already installed.
No update candidate for 'nfs-doc-2.1.1-lp152.8.2.x86_64'. The highest available version is already installed.
'pciutils-ids' is already installed.
No update candidate for 'pciutils-ids-20190830-lp152.1.1.noarch'. The highest available version is already installed.
'emacs-info' is already installed.
No update candidate for 'emacs-info-25.3-lp152.4.72.noarch'. The highest available version is already installed.
'texlive-texware' is already installed.
No update candidate for 'texlive-texware-2017.134.svn44166-lp152.6.2.noarch'. The highest available version is already installed.
'texlive-stix2-otf-doc' not found in package names. Trying capabilities.
No provider of 'texlive-stix2-otf-doc' found.
'texlive-stix2-otf-fonts' not found in package names. Trying capabilities.
No provider of 'texlive-stix2-otf-fonts' found.
'texlive-stix2-type1-doc' not found in package names. Trying capabilities.
No provider of 'texlive-stix2-type1-doc' found.
'texlive-stix2-type1-fonts' not found in package names. Trying capabilities.
No provider of 'texlive-stix2-type1-fonts' found.


That, I don’t know about. Perhaps it will be created at about the time 15.2 is released.

The second is that the list of community repositories is almost empty, and does not include packman.

This seems pretty normal at this stage. The list is typically prepared at around the time of the official release.

Last, I get out-of-date error messages on one of the standard repositories

I am ignoring that. I sometimes see that message even for the current release. It seems to be just a check on timestamps. Until release time, the update repos are really being used, except for a few test updates in the main update repo.

It’s not just a warning message - nothing gets installed. Take whois: it’s just silently ignored.

I can’t comment on the particular install attempt, since I don’t know the details.

I see that warning message about out-of-date repo at every update (with 15.2). Yet it updates just fine.

FWIW, the URL for the LEAP 15.1 texlive repository was http://download.opensuse.org/repositories/Publishing:/TeXLive/openSUSE_Leap_15.1/

Should I open a ticket for any of these issues, or assume that the packagers are already aware of them?

I expect that they are already aware of them.

For past releases, most of those additional repos were not created until release time (give or take a week). Even the packman repos used to not be available until two or three weeks before release. I’m very happy that the packman folk are now providing the repos earlier. I would not worry about the others. If they are really essential to you, then you should be waiting for the official release before going to 15.2.

No. These repos get populated after the freeze of Leap 15.2 development. Before that, every change in any requirement of a package would trigger a rebuild of the packages in such repos. Just imagine what the impact on the buildservice would be. Most likely Texlive ( thousands of packages ) would be rebuilding constantly.

My thoughts as well. Ok, to test, but don’t expect the repo environment to be complete yet.